Make Body's的宽度是使用CSS和JS的Screen的两倍
Make Body's width as a doubling of Screen with CSS and JS
我想让Body的宽度是Screen的两倍。
对于exmaple,
如果屏幕的宽度(确切地说,窗口)是500px,
那么Body的宽度应该是1000px。
我只能使用HTML、CSS和Javascript
因为服务器不允许我使用PHP或其他程序。
那么,如何使用CSS和JS呢?
您可以使用浏览器窗口单元:
body { width: 200vw; }
这意味着"当前视口宽度的200%"。您也可以将vh
用于"视口高度"。这在IE9中得到了支持。
请注意,在<body>
需要填充的情况下,使用"边界框"框大小可能是个好主意。你可以为你的页面设置这样的默认值:
body { box-sizing: border-box; }
body *, body *:before, body *:after { box-sizing: inherit; }
您可以在%
中指定宽度,如下所示:
html,body{
width:200%;
}
或使用类似vw
的
body{
width:200vw; /*less browser support*/
}
仅IE9
、FF30、chrome27、Opera 23支持此单元。
vw
浏览器支持@caniuse。
相关文章:
- 可以't让我的if语句处理js中的html表单输入
- 使用agility.js进行页面布局和合成
- 使用Clipboard.js复制span文本
- 使用JS如何动态更改显示的html文件中的文本背景颜色
- 强制模板刷新ember.js
- 如何编写HTML输入的JS内联
- Angular JS IE9 Hashbang url rewriting
- 使用JS将数组转换为json对象
- Node.js v6.2.0类扩展不是函数错误
- 当js函数's已执行
- 要求未定义JS回调参数
- 在自定义mean.io包中使用angular-chart.js作为依赖项
- 无法在数据endVal中设置值=“”;{{ucount}}”;使用Angular JS的CountUp
- 如何从Java/scala调用js美化程序
- 如何更改<svg>标记为<img>用js标记
- 如何使用 node.js 比较两个 json 数组
- chrome扩展:尽管运行了at:documentidle,js脚本还是过早启动
- 节点Js:How to catch a“;没有这样的文件或目录“;读取线模块出错
- Make Body's的宽度是使用CSS和JS的Screen的两倍
- screen.width JS属性的值